Ardour will allow you to automate changes to any mixing - parameters (such as volume, panning, and effects controls) - it will + parameters (such as volume, panning, and effects controls)—it will record the changes you make over time, using a mouse or keyboard or some external control device, and can play back those changes later. This is very useful because often the settings you need will vary in one part of - a session compared to another — rather than using a single setting + a session compared to another—rather than using a single setting for the volume, you may need increases followed by decreases (for example, to track the changing volume of a singer). Using automation can make all of this relatively simple. @@ -107,5 +108,4 @@ system. Ardour will allow you to export as much of a session as you want, at any time, in any supported format.
